# FunASR 语音转录
|
||||
|
||||
本地、免费、高效的语音识别工具,基于阿里巴巴 FunASR 模型。
|
||||
|
||||
## 快速开始
|
||||
|
||||
```bash
|
||||
# 1. 安装 FunASR
|
||||
bash ~/.openclaw/workspace/skills/funasr-transcribe/scripts/install.sh
|
||||
|
||||
# 2. 转录音频
|
||||
bash ~/.openclaw/workspace/skills/funasr-transcribe/scripts/transcribe.sh /path/to/audio.ogg
|
||||
```
|
||||
|
||||
## 安装 FunASR
|
||||
|
||||
首次使用需要安装 FunASR 环境(虚拟环境 + 依赖):
|
||||
|
||||
```bash
|
||||
bash ~/.openclaw/workspace/skills/funasr-transcribe/scripts/install.sh
|
||||
```
|
||||
|
||||
安装脚本会:
|
||||
- 创建 Python 虚拟环境 `~/.openclaw/workspace/funasr_env`
|
||||
- 安装 FunASR、torch、torchaudio、modelscope 等依赖
|
||||
- 安装完成后,首次转录会自动下载模型文件
|
||||
|
||||
**安装时间**:约 5-10 分钟(取决于网络速度)
|
||||
|
||||
**系统要求**:
|
||||
- Python 3.7+
|
||||
- 约 4GB 磁盘空间(虚拟环境 + 模型)
|
||||
- 推荐 8GB+ 内存
|
||||
|
||||
## 转录音频
|
||||
|
||||
安装完成后,转录音频:
|
||||
|
||||
```bash
|
||||
bash ~/.openclaw/workspace/skills/funasr-transcribe/scripts/transcribe.sh /path/to/audio.ogg
|
||||
```
|
||||
|
||||
**支持的格式**:`.wav`, `.ogg`, `.mp3`, `.flac`, `.m4a` 等
|
||||
|
||||
**输出**:
|
||||
- 同目录下生成 `<audio_filename>.txt`
|
||||
- 包含转录文本(带标点)
|
||||
|
||||
**性能**:
|
||||
- CPU 推理:rtf 约 0.05-0.2(1 秒音频约需 0.05-0.2 秒)
|
||||
- 首次转录需下载模型(约 1-2GB),后续直接使用缓存
|
||||
|
||||
## 技术细节
|
||||
|
||||
FunASR 使用以下模型组合:
|
||||
- **ASR 模型**:`damo/speech_paraformer-large_asr_nat-zh-cn-16k-common-vocab8404-pytorch`(中文优化)
|
||||
- **VAD 模型**:`damo/speech_fsmn_vad_zh-cn-16k-common-pytorch`(语音活动检测)
|
||||
- **标点模型**:`damo/punc_ct-transformer_zh-cn-common-vocab272727-pytorch`(标点恢复)
|
||||
|
||||
**语言支持**:
|
||||
- 中文(普通话 + 方言)
|
||||
- 英文
|
||||
- 中英混合
|
||||
|
||||
## 常见问题
|
||||
|
||||
**Q: 首次转录很慢?**
|
||||
A: 首次运行会自动下载模型文件(约 1-2GB),后续转录会快很多。
|
||||
|
||||
**Q: 可以用 GPU 吗?**
|
||||
A: 可以。编辑 `scripts/transcribe.py`,将 `device="cpu"` 改为 `device="cuda:0"`,并安装对应的 CUDA 版本依赖。
|
||||
|
||||
**Q: 转录准确率如何?**
|
||||
A: FunASR 在中文场景下表现优异,通常优于 OpenAI Whisper。建议测试后评估效果。

#!/usr/bin/env python3
|
||||
"""FunASR 音频转录脚本"""
|
||||
|
||||
import sys
|
||||
import os
|
||||
import json
|
||||
|
||||
try:
|
||||
from funasr import AutoModel
|
||||
except ImportError:
|
||||
print("❌ 错误:未找到 funasr 模块")
|
||||
print("")
|
||||
print("请先安装 FunASR:")
|
||||
print(" bash ~/.openclaw/workspace/skills/funasr-transcribe/scripts/install.sh")
|
||||
sys.exit(1)
|
||||
|
||||
|
||||
def transcribe_audio(audio_path):
|
||||
"""使用 FunASR 转录音频"""
|
||||
print(f"正在处理音频: {audio_path}")
|
||||
print("首次运行会自动下载模型,可能需要几分钟...")
|
||||
|
||||
# 加载模型
|
||||
model = AutoModel(
|
||||
model="damo/speech_paraformer-large_asr_nat-zh-cn-16k-common-vocab8404-pytorch",
|
||||
vad_model="damo/speech_fsmn_vad_zh-cn-16k-common-pytorch",
|
||||
punc_model="damo/punc_ct-transformer_zh-cn-common-vocab272727-pytorch",
|
||||
device="cpu" # 使用 CPU,如果有 GPU 可以改为 "cuda:0"
|
||||
)
|
||||
|
||||
# 进行语音识别
|
||||
res = model.generate(
|
||||
input=audio_path,
|
||||
batch_size_s=300
|
||||
)
|
||||
|
||||
return res
|
||||
|
||||
|
||||
def main():
|
||||
if len(sys.argv) < 2:
|
||||
print("用法: python3 transcribe.py <audio_file>")
|
||||
sys.exit(1)
|
||||
|
||||
audio_path = sys.argv[1]
|
||||
|
||||
# 检查文件是否存在
|
||||
if not os.path.exists(audio_path):
|
||||
print(f"❌ 错误:文件不存在: {audio_path}")
|
||||
sys.exit(1)
|
||||
|
||||
# 转录
|
||||
try:
|
||||
result = transcribe_audio(audio_path)
|
||||
except Exception as e:
|
||||
print(f"❌ 转录失败: {e}")
|
||||
sys.exit(1)
|
||||
|
||||
# 输出结果
|
||||
text = ""
|
||||
if isinstance(result, list) and len(result) > 0:
|
||||
text = result[0].get("text", "")
|
||||
|
||||
if not text:
|
||||
print("⚠️ 未识别到文本")
|
||||
sys.exit(0)
|
||||
|
||||
print("\n" + "="*50)
|
||||
print("转录结果:")
|
||||
print("="*50)
|
||||
print(text)
|
||||
|
||||
# 保存到文件
|
||||
output_path = os.path.splitext(audio_path)[0] + ".txt"
|
||||
try:
|
||||
with open(output_path, "w", encoding="utf-8") as f:
|
||||
f.write(text)
|
||||
print("")
|
||||
print(f"✓ 已保存到: {output_path}")
|
||||
except Exception as e:
|
||||
print(f"\n⚠️ 保存文件失败: {e}")
|
||||
|
||||
|
||||
if __name__ == "__main__":
|
||||
main()
